Valentin Vacherot faces Martin Damm Jr tonight at the Australian Open. The 27-year-old Monegasque enters with heavy momentum after winning his first ATP Masters 1000 title just weeks ago. Damm, ranked 177th, will battle the tournament’s rising 32nd-ranked star.

Valentin Vacherot has never been in better form. Just weeks ago, the 27-year-old stunned the tennis world in Shanghai. He became the lowest-ranked ATP Masters 1000 champion ever, climbing from world No. 204 in qualifying. That fairytale run culminated in a victory over his cousin.
His Australian Open appearance marks the start of his next chapter. Vacherot carried his recent confidence into Melbourne. The Monegasque arrives as a clear 37th seed in the tournament. Every match now determines if his Shanghai magic was a breakthrough or a blip.

Martin Damm Jr, the 22-year-old American, brings youth but limited pedigree. Born in Bradenton, Florida, the rising prospect stands 6-foot-8 and weighs 209 pounds, giving him physical tools. However, his ATP ranking of 177 shows limited professional success.
Damm has competed mostly at lower circuits. His path to the Australian Open main draw required qualifying rounds. This first-round matchup against Vacherot represents a major test. Damm enters as a significant underdog but possesses the size and athleticism to compete.
